Most Americans spend 90% of their time indoors, which means we all ought to take a closer look at our indoor air quality. Truthfully, mold is everywhere. However, elevated levels can be problematic. Mold grows because of moisture, so in our dry Montana climate, it typically shows up in poorly ventilated areas or areas that have been affected by water damage. Buffalo Restoration's source removal techniques for mold remediation follow industry best practices. Simply killing the mold is not the answer. We use techniques to physically remove the mold and keep it from spreading elsewhere in the home.
The first step in mold remediation is an inspection. Buffalo's experienced expert will perform a visual examination of the suspected areas and advise you on the best course of action.
If your home has experienced moisture intrusion, water damage, musty odors, apparent mold growth, or conditions conducive to mold growth, Buffalo Restoration offers air sample testing to collect data about mold spores present in the interior of your home. Having your samples analyzed by a third-party laboratory can help provide evidence of the scope and severity of a mold problem, as well as aid in assessing your exposure to mold spores.
We'll create a containment around the mold before we begin work so that we don't spread spores throughout the house. We use full PPE gear when working with mold to protect our employees and prevent them from tracking spores through the house when they leave.
Buffalo uses a number of removal techniques, including specialty mold cleaners, HEPA vacuuming, wire brushing, and media blasting. A comprehensive approach is far superior to simply spraying the mold. Even when mold and fungal spores are killed without physical removal, these methods do not eliminate the allergenic or toxigenic properties. We'll also clean and sanitize the entire affected area or room.
Clean and dry areas are not susceptible to mold growth. After the remediation process, we will consult with you on how to reduce or prevent conditions for future mold growth.
